Cal. Bus. & Prof. Code § 3508

(a) The board may convene from time to time as deemed necessary by the board.

(b) Notice of each meeting of the board shall be given at least two weeks in advance to those persons and organizations who express an interest in receiving notification.

(c) The board shall receive permission of the director to meet more than six times annually. The director shall approve meetings that are necessary for the board to fulfill its legal responsibilities.
